Sant Vijay Singh vs State Of U P And Others

High Court Of Judicature at Allahabad|20 December, 2021
|

JUDGMENT / ORDER

Court No. - 40
Case :- WRIT - C No. - 28630 of 2021
Petitioner :- Sant Vijay Singh
Respondent :- State Of U.P. And 6 Others Counsel for Petitioner :- Arun Kumar Singh Counsel for Respondent :- C.S.C.
Hon'ble Ashwani Kumar Mishra,J. Hon'ble Vikram D. Chauhan,J.
Order on Civil Misc. Impleadment Application No. Nil of 2021 Impeadment Application filed by Sri Dheeraj Singh, who is also one of the defendant in the suit, is allowed.
Order on the petition It transpires that Original Suit No. 2342 of 2018 has been instituted by the sixth respondent against the petitioner in respect of the property in question which is pending before the competent court and order of injunction has also been passed directing the parties to maintain status quo. It appears that there was some threat to peace and tranquility on the spot on account of which the local police has put a lock on the house of the petitioner. The action taken by the police authorities to put lock on the petitioner's house is assailed on the ground that in extreme winter the petitioner is forced to stay out of his house in open and even domestic animal etc. are tied within the house itself.
Taking note of such contention, we called upon learned Standing Counsel to obtain instructions in the matter. The instructions have been received, as per which, there was a threat to peace on the spot and, therefore, proceedings under Section 107/116 CrPC were undertaken on 10.10.2021. According to police authorities, they have only tried to enforce the order passed by the trial court. As per the instructions, the petitioner is trying to change the nature of the suit properties which necessitated the action by the local police.
Learned counsel for the petitioner states that petitioner shall not alter the status quo and neither any construction would be raised nor any demolition etc. would be carried out.
In the facts of the case, since the parties are already contesting the matter before the civil court, wherein an order of status quo has already been passed, we do not approve the action of the police authorities to put lock on the petitioner's house. Since an order of status quo is already operating, we provide that the petitioner shall be put back in possession and for such purposes the police authorities shall remove their lock forthwith.
None of the parties, however, shall change the nature of the suit property and the injunction granted by the competent civil court for maintenance of status quo would be respected by both the parties.
Leaving it open for the civil court to resolve the matter in accordance with law, expeditiously, we dispose off this petition.
It is also provided that no adjournment would be granted to either of the parties in the pending suit and all endeavours would be made to conclude it expeditiously. The police authorities shall be at liberty to ensure peace and tranquility on the spot in accordance with law.
Order Date :- 20.12.2021 VMA
